Chrome users: Chrome BROKE (https://developer.chrome.com/blog/visited-links) the visited link functionality that distincts out the links your browser already visited. It's a big deal, #Petrolette UX relies on it. Currently working on Pétrolette2 which will handle this internally and no longer rely on browser buggy (yes, it IS a bug, I have no time for this now) implementations. In the meantime, #Chrome users, here is a workaround:
chrome://flags/#partition-visited-link-database-with-self-links / Select "Disabled"
The #petrolette (cloud) host is down, investigating, please bear with us.
In the meantime remember that you can install and use it locally: https://framagit.org/yphil/petrolette
git clone https://framagit.org/yphil/petrolette.git
cd petrolette
npm install
npm run dev
xdg-open http://localhost:8000
